Method 1: Using the Built-in Features
The good news is that most Android devices come with built-in features that allow you to hide text messages. One of these features is the “Private mode” option. To enable this, go to your device’s settings and select “Privacy.” From there, you can turn on the private mode, which will hide all your text messages from the main messaging app. However, this will only hide the messages from the main app, and they can still be visible in other apps such as your notifications or recent apps.
Another built-in feature is the “Archive” option. This will move selected conversations to a hidden folder, making them invisible from the main messaging app. To use this feature, open the messaging app and long-press on the conversation you want to hide. Then, select the “Archive” option, and the conversation will be moved to a hidden folder.
Method 2: Using Third-Party Apps
If you want more control over which messages to hide and where to hide them, you can use third-party apps. These apps offer more advanced features, such as password protection, fake password protection, and the ability to hide messages from multiple messaging apps. Some of the most popular apps for hiding text messages on Android include Hide SMS, Vault, and Private Message Box.
Hide SMS is a simple and easy-to-use app that allows you to hide text messages and call logs. You can choose to hide individual messages or entire conversations. The app also has the option to set a fake password, which will show a fake inbox with no messages if someone tries to access it.
Vault is another popular app that not only hides text messages but also offers additional features like hiding photos, videos, and apps. You can also set a password for the app, and it has a feature called “Stealth mode,” which hides the app from your device’s app drawer.
Private Message Box is a free app that lets you hide your messages in a private box, protected by a password. It also has an auto-lock feature, which will automatically lock the app after a specified time of inactivity.
Method 3: Using Launchers
Another way to hide text messages is by using launchers. Launchers are apps that allow you to customize your home screen and app icons. Some launchers, like Nova Launcher, offer the option to hide apps from the app drawer. You can simply hide your messaging app, and it will not be visible to anyone using your device.

In recent years, the rise of e-commerce has made it easier for scammers to target unsuspecting consumers. One of the most common methods used by scammers is through fake order confirmation emails. These emails are designed to look like legitimate order confirmation emails from reputable companies, but in reality, they are sent by scammers with the intention of stealing personal information or money from unsuspecting customers.
So, how do you spot a fake order confirmation email in 2021? There are a few key elements to look out for. First, pay attention to the sender’s email address. Legitimate companies will have a professional email address that is associated with their brand. If the email address looks suspicious or does not match the company’s name, it’s likely a fake email.
Another red flag to look out for is the content of the email itself. Fake order confirmation emails often contain spelling and grammar errors, which is a telltale sign of a scam. Legitimate companies will have a team of professionals who proofread their emails before sending them out, so errors are rare.
Furthermore, fake order confirmation emails may also ask for personal information, such as credit card numbers or login credentials. It’s important to remember that legitimate companies will never ask for this type of information through email. If you receive an email asking for personal information, do not respond to it and report it to the company immediately.
Additionally, fake order confirmation emails may also contain attachments or links that, when clicked, can install malware onto your device. These attachments or links may appear to be from the company, but in reality, they are designed to steal your personal information. It’s important to never click on any links or open any attachments from suspicious emails.

So, how can you protect yourself from fake order confirmation emails in 2021? The first step is to be vigilant and pay attention to the details of the email. As mentioned earlier, check the sender’s email address, look for spelling and grammar errors, and never provide personal information in response to an email.
Another way to protect yourself is to use email filters or anti-spam software. These tools can help identify and block suspicious emails from reaching your inbox. Additionally, keeping your operating system and antivirus software up to date can also help protect against malware.
If you receive a suspicious order confirmation email, it’s important to report it to the company it claims to be from. Most companies have dedicated email addresses or phone numbers for reporting scams and fraud. By reporting the email, you can help protect other customers from falling victim to the same scam.
